The Minnesota Vikings have unveiled an innovative training and recovery strategy designed to aid J.J. McCarthy, the No. 10 overall draft pick, in overcoming a significant knee injury that sidelined him during the 2024 season. McCarthy, who has been unable to take the field this year, has used the time to focus on enhancing his physical conditioning and preparing mentally for the 643 2025 season. This comprehensive approach is part of the Vikings’ broader effort to ensure McCarthy is ready to lead the team in the upcoming year.
